Carson's body was found in March on a street not far from the
campus in Chapel Hill.
Prosecutors have charged two young Durham men with first-degree
murder in the case.
The autopsy report had been completed weeks ago but was sealed
until today. Prosecutors say it shows both a handgun and a shotgun
were used in the attack. They are searching for the weapons.
In court documents released last week, authorities say a
confidential informant told police that the suspects entered
Carson's home through an open door and took her to an ATM. They
ended up withdrawing about $1,400 over two days.
The informant also said that both suspects shot Carson.
